Ingredients for Baked Blueberry French Toast
- 1 pound French Bread
- 8 ounces softened Neufchatel cheese
- 4 large eggs
- 1/2 cup pure maple syrup
- 1 1/4 cups low-fat sour cream
- 1 cup plain low-fat yogurt
- 1/2 cup milk
- 1 teaspoon ground cinnamon
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1 1/4 cups blueberries

How to Make Baked Blueberry French Toast
-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ease a 3- to 4-quart casserole dish.
- Cut 1 pound of whole-grain bread into 1/2-inch cubes.
- In a food processor, combine 8 ounces softened Neufchâtel cheese, 4 large eggs, and 1/2 cup pure maple syrup. Process until smooth.
- Add 1 cup low-fat sour cream, 1 cup plain low-fat yogurt, 1/2 cup milk, 1 teaspoon ground cinnamon, and 1 teaspoon vanilla extract. Process until smooth.
- Place half of the bread cubes in a single layer in the prepared baking dish.
- Sprinkle 1 cup of blueberries (or mixed berries) evenly over the bread.
- Pour half of the cream cheese mixture over the berries, spreading evenly.
- Layer the remaining bread cubes on top, then pour the remaining cream cheese mixture over the bread, spreading evenly.
- Cover tightly with foil and bake for 30 minutes.
- Remove the foil and bake for another 30 minutes, or until the French toast is set, puffy, and lightly browned.
- Let cool slightly before garnishing with 1/4 cup sour cream and 1/4 cup blueberries. Serve warm with extra maple syrup.
